Forecast: Sold Production of Tableware and Kitchenware of Plastic in Germany

In 2023, the sold production of tableware and kitchenware of plastic in Germany stood at approximately 55 million kilograms. This data highlights a downward trend from 2024 through 2028, with annual decreases in production volumes. Specifically, from 2024 to 2025, there is a decline of nearly 6.8%. This trend continues, with a further decrease of approximately 7.2% by 2026, 7.7% by 2027, and culminating in a 7.9% decrease by 2028, indicating a consistent reduction in production.

Over the five-year period from 2024 to 2028, the compound annual growth rate (CAGR) reflects an average annual decrease in production of about 7%. This suggests a substantial, ongoing shift away from plastic usage in this sector.

Future trends to watch for include:

  • A possible shift towards sustainable and eco-friendly materials as consumer preferences and regulatory pressures increase.
  • Technological advancements in alternative material production could accelerate the decline in plastic use.
  • Economic impacts on production costs and potential shifts in global trade policies influencing domestic production.
